2017-04-20 55 views
0

我一直在试图安装企业库6,这是一个痛苦。我试过Enterprise Library 6: Installation and VS2012 Configuration,但是我遇到了powershell命令的问题。我也尝试打开install-packages.ps1并粘贴在PowerShell中,我保持继续错误。我不确定它是否是我的机器以及它的限制,但我不想只通过一次调用存储过程来完成此安装过程。添加没有PowerShell的企业库6?

我很少使用powershell,我不想今天开始学习它。有没有办法只下载需要的DLL并将它们添加为我的项目的参考?

我已经加入Microsoft.Practices.EnterpriseLibrary.Data作为参考,并生成项目很好,但它运行时,我得到一个错误用的方法之一。似乎还有其他dll需要添加(Microsoft.Practices.EnterpriseLibrary.Common)等等。

我只想下载这些DLL并将它们添加为参考。我不想通过任何安装过程。

这可能吗?谢谢。

+0

如果您分享了错误,那么这将非常有用,因此我们可以理解完全问题。 –

+0

没有问题。我只想知道我是否可以在不使用nuget或PowerShell的情况下使用Enterprise Library 6。我似乎可以。 – rbhat

回答

0

我下载了Microsoft.Practices.EnterpriseLibrary.ConfigConsoleV6.vsix。然后我打开winrar,复制/粘贴Microsoft.Practices.EnterpriseLibrary.Common.dll到我的bin文件夹,并添加为我的项目的参考。

然后我从nuget.org下载了enterpriselibrary.data.6.0.1304.nupkg并用winrar打开它。然后,我将Microsoft.Practices.EnterpriseLibrary.Data.dll复制/粘贴到我的bin文件夹中,并作为参考添加到我的项目中。